Kelly Clarkson's tribute to Dolly Parton at the 57th Academy of Country Music Awards gave fans a breath-taking performance to remember.

Since she first shot to fame after winning American Idol two decades ago, Kelly Clarkson has won the hearts of music fans across the world. And despite her personal life being full of challenges in recent months in light of Kelly and Brandon Blackstock’s divorce, career-wise the star is still going from strength to strength. Just last year Kelly was confirmed for the Ellen DeGeneres Show’s slot after it was announced that the popular Ellen talk show would end after 19 seasons and she continues to be a supportive coach on The Voice.

Now it's Kelly Clarkson's tribute to Dolly Parton at this year’s ACM Awards that we're all talking about as she showcased her own magnificent voice in her latest appearance. Taking to the stage she performed one of the greatest hits of all time—none other than I Will Always Love You!

Opting for a glamorous black dress, Kelly sang her heart out and left the audience in no doubt about who the performance was dedicated to as she called, “Give it up for Dolly Parton!” as she left the stage. 

As the esteemed host of the ACM Awards 2022 Dolly Parton was there to witness Kelly’s heartfelt declaration in person. The singer released the romantic song in 1974, before the late great Whitney Huston made it a global favorite again in 1992 with her cover for The Bodyguard soundtrack. 

Addressing the song’ history, Dolly told attendees and viewers, “I know that Whitney is smiling down on us tonight, so thank you very much—she would be proud of that.”

"I was backstage trying not to cry my false eyelashes off—slinging snot in every direction and tears," the country music icon added. "But anyway, that was an amazing job!"

But it’s not just Dolly’s seal of approval that Kelly secured with her astonishing rendition of I Will Always Love You. Fans were quick to praise the American Idol winner’s vocal performance, with some dubbing it the “best” one of the night. 

“Still can’t believe [how] beautiful that was. And the[n] Dolly comes out to thank her. Perfect. So happy I was able to be there to witness it,” one person declared excitedly.

Kelly Clarkson’s tribute to Dolly Parton came just over a week after the singer broke the news about her ACMs performance. Taking to Instagram, Kelly shared a teaser for her upcoming appearance, declaring, “One word: DOLLY. 👸🏼”.

“That's right, y'all! I'm so excited to announce that during this year’s @ACMawards, I’ll be performing a tribute to the show’s host @DollyParton! 🎤,” she added excitedly. 

After days of waiting and wondering just what the tribute would be, Kelly certainly pulled off one of the most unforgettable ACM performances this year.
